What’s Inside:

  • Baby Update: Your little one’s the size of a cauliflower head (2-2.5 lbs, 14.5-15 inches), plumping up with brown fat, maturing lungs, and practicing those cute sucking motions.
  • Your Body: From achy joints to heartburn, shortness of breath, Braxton Hicks, and swelling - Trish breaks down what’s normal and tips to ease the discomfort (think prenatal yoga, small meals, and hydration).
  • Third Trimester Prep: Keep it simple - focus on a safe sleep space, diapers, and a few outfits. Start your hospital bag (check out labornursemama.com/third for a free checklist!) and talk birth preferences with your provider.
  • Emotional Rollercoaster: Feeling anxious or grieving your old life? It’s all valid. Try balancing fears with gratitude (ex., “I’m scared of labor, but I’m so excited to meet my baby”).
